MAX665CWE Description
The MAX665CWE is a fixed-output, charge-pump inverter designed for power management applications. Manufactured by Analog Devices Inc./Maxim Integrated, this IC regulator offers a robust solution for generating negative voltages from a positive input supply. The MAX665CWE operates over a wide input voltage range from 1.5V to 8V and provides a stable output current of up to 100mA. This device is particularly suited for applications requiring a negative voltage supply, leveraging its ratiometric function to maintain a fixed output voltage ratio relative to the input.
MAX665CWE Features
- Fixed Output Type: The MAX665CWE provides a fixed output voltage, ensuring consistent performance across a wide range of input voltages.
- Wide Input Voltage Range: With an input voltage range of 1.5V to 8V, the MAX665CWE is versatile and can be used in various power supply scenarios.
- High Output Current: The device supports an output current of up to 100mA, making it suitable for applications requiring moderate power levels.
- Positive or Negative Output Configuration: The MAX665CWE can be configured to provide either positive or negative output voltages, offering flexibility in design.
- Ratiometric Function: The ratiometric function ensures that the output voltage maintains a fixed ratio to the input voltage, enhancing stability and reliability.
- Dual Switching Frequencies: The MAX665CWE operates at switching frequencies of 10kHz and 45kHz, allowing designers to optimize for either low noise or high efficiency.
- Surface Mount Packaging: The MAX665CWE is available in a surface mount package, facilitating easy integration into compact designs.
- Moisture Sensitivity Level 1: With an MSL of 1, the MAX665CWE is suitable for unlimited exposure to standard manufacturing environments, reducing handling constraints.
- Operating Temperature Range: The device operates reliably within a temperature range of 0°C to 70°C, making it suitable for a variety of ambient conditions.
MAX665CWE Applications
The MAX665CWE is ideal for applications requiring a stable negative voltage supply from a positive input. Specific use cases include:
- Analog Circuits: Providing negative supply rails for operational amplifiers and other analog components.
- Data Acquisition Systems: Supplying negative bias voltages for ADCs and DACs.
- Battery-Powered Devices: Generating negative voltages from a single-cell battery source.
- Medical Equipment: Ensuring stable power supply for sensitive medical devices.
- Industrial Control Systems: Offering reliable power conversion in harsh industrial environments.
